How can small businesses effectively measure the success of their personalized recommendations, omnichannel experiences, and customer service strategies in order to continuously improve and compete with larger companies like Amazon, Apple, and Zappos?
Small businesses can measure the success of their personalized recommendations, omnichannel experiences, and customer service strategies by tracking key performance indicators such as conversion rates, customer satisfaction scores, and repeat purchase rates. They can also gather feedback from customers through surveys, reviews, and social media to understand what is working well and what needs improvement. By analyzing data and benchmarking against industry standards, small businesses can identify areas of strength and weakness to make informed decisions on how to enhance their offerings and better compete with larger companies. Additionally, investing in technology and tools that provide insights into customer behavior and preferences can help small businesses tailor their strategies for better results and increased competitiveness.
